What is Wave Accounting?
Wave Accounting is a cloud-based accounting platform designed to simplify financial management for small business owners and self-employed individuals. Launched in 2009, Wave aims to provide accessible and intuitive tools for tracking income, expenses, and overall financial performance without the need for extensive accounting knowledge.

Wave Accounting Features: A Closer Look
Wave Accounting offers an impressive array of features, making it an all-in-one solution for managing finances. Here’s a breakdown of its primary tools:
1. Free Accounting Software
Wave’s accounting software enables users to:
- Track income and expenses.
- Automate transaction categorization.
- Monitor cash flow in real-time.
- Generate financial statements for insights into business performance.
2. Invoicing and Payments
- Create and send professional invoices in minutes.
- Set up recurring invoices for ongoing clients.
- Accept payments through credit cards or ACH bank transfers.
- Get notified when clients view or pay invoices.
3. Receipt Scanning
- Snap photos of receipts using the Wave mobile app.
- Automatically match receipts to transactions for accurate expense tracking.
4. Payroll (Paid Feature)
- Simplify payroll processing for employees and contractors.
- Automate tax calculations and filings in supported regions.
- Offer direct deposit and self-service portals for employees.
5. Financial Reporting
Wave allows users to generate various reports, such as:
- Profit and Loss Statements.
- Balance Sheets.
- Sales Tax Reports.
- Aged Receivables.
6. Multi-Currency Support
Conduct business internationally with support for multiple currencies, ensuring seamless financial tracking across borders.

Wave Accounting vs. Competitors
Feature | Wave Accounting | QuickBooks Online | FreshBooks |
---|---|---|---|
Cost | Free (core features) | $25+/month | $17+/month |
Ease of Use | Very User-Friendly | Moderate | Very User-Friendly |
Invoicing | Free | Paid Add-On | Included |
Bank Integration | Free | Paid | Paid |
Payroll | Paid Add-On | Paid Add-On | Paid Add-On |
Wave stands out for its affordability, offering free accounting and invoicing features that competitors charge for.
Challenges and Limitations of Wave Accounting
While Wave Accounting is a robust platform, it’s not without its limitations:
1. Limited Features for Larger Businesses
Wave is best suited for small businesses and freelancers. Larger businesses with complex needs may find it lacking.
2. Paid Add-Ons
While core features are free, additional tools like payroll and premium support come at a cost.
3. No Inventory Management
Wave does not offer inventory tracking, which may be a drawback for businesses with stock management needs.
4. Customer Support
Free users rely on self-help resources and forums, as live support is limited to paid users.
